1031 Update on Capitol Hill – August 2022

The Inflation Reduction Act was passed by Congress and signed into law by President Biden on August 16, 2022 without any changes to section 1031. This victory was the culmination of a vigorous, multiyear effort by employees of IPX1031, members of the Federation of Exchange Accommodators, and the 1031 Coalition which is comprised of more than 30 separate trade organizations to oppose President Biden’s campaign proposal to eliminate and later, to limit gain deferral under section 1031 at $500,000.
